This is an ubuntu packaging issue and not a libreoffice issue, hence
marking as notourbug.

(Some backgroudn:
Draw and Impress are highly dependent on each other and share most of their 
code. That means that if you install only impress, you also end up with a lot 
of draw installed too and vice versa.

On ubuntu most of the necessary libraries are contained in the draw
package [http://packages.ubuntu.com/precise/i386/libreoffice-
draw/filelist -- libsd*.so contain most of the draw and impress code].
Thus for impress to work draw is needed in order for the shared
libraries the be present. The impress package then simply adds some
additional files also needed for impress to function
[http://packages.ubuntu.com/precise/i386/libreoffice-impress/filelist].

On Opensuse the shared libraries are all in the main libreoffice package
with the draw and impress packages containing the few additional files
needed specifically or draw or impress (registry entries and desktop
files, and a few other minor draw or impress specific files), allowing
them to actually be installed separately.)

Bug description:
  Binary package hint: openoffice.org-impress

  When I try to remove openoffice.org-draw from my system I also need to
  remove openoffice.org-impress; this behaviour annoyes me, since I've
  never ever used -draw (or even the related functionalities), but I
  frequently use -impress to do some very simple (and very useful) work.

  Common functionalities can be exported into openoffice.org-common, or
  disabled when -draw isn't installed.

  This behaviour is common to every version of ubuntu so far, including
  packages from openoffice-pkgs ppa (openoffice.org 3).
